Subject: Gross-margin review — quick heads-up

Hi all,

Before Thursday's board session, a quick note: the gross-margin review on the Valtera line came in better than feared. Materials costs dropped after the Korvane supplier switch, and the Brightlow facility is finally running at capacity. Merrin will walk the board through the detail. One item stays off the main deck — the confidential plan note is below.

management briefing: Eliaxax Works is in early talks to buy Casoxox Systems for about $61.5 million. The Framir launch date is May 17, and nothing goes to the press before then.

## Approvals: Template Rendering Performance

Any change to the Quillfern template renderer that affects hot-path performance requires approval before merge. This includes caching changes, partial-eval tweaks, and modifications to the precompile step. Benchmarks must be run against the Larkspur corpus and attached to the review; regressions over 3% are rejected by default. Exceptions need a written rationale in the change description. All such approvals route to a single owner, named below.

named custodian: Belius Casath Ulaix Sorius

Ticket: Staging quotas ignored for Brindlehook plugins

Plugin authors reported that per-tenant rate quotas on the Farrowgate staging gateway were not enforced this week. Root cause: the quota service env file was missing two entries, so all tenants fell back to the unlimited default. QUOTA_TIER_MAP and QUOTA_WINDOW_SECONDS have been restored. The quota service also signs its enforcement calls with a credential, which the env file sets on the next line.

vault entry, yahif-yajep: COURIER_KEY29=b802bdf8034096b65a51c6ba5abe2

Contractors at the Verlano Works site are escorted by their sponsor for the first week of engagement. Night shift staff should log each entry in the lobby register and confirm the contractor's scope of works before admitting them past the turnstiles. After the escort period, contractors may use the service corridor door with the code below.

badge for tageg-bajep: bdg-ZR-3